Are my brakes Teves or Brembo ?

2009 330D LCI - standard rear brakes

Im looking at Europarts for replacement pads for my rear brakes. There are 2 types listed for my car; Teves and Brembo for both Pagid and Textar pads.

Am I correct in assuming that my brakes are Teves calipers and not Brembo ones ?

I know Brembo are known for their high performance brakes but it occurred to me that they may also make stanadard OEM stuff too. So thought Id better check.

Quote:
Originally Posted by parapaul View Post
Shouldn't matter. Whoever they're made by, they should be the same shape and size. The only difference could be pre/post LCI.
It does matter because according to Eurocarparts the E91 comes with either Teves or Brembo calipers and offer the Pagid and Textar pads for the Brembo caliper at a much higher price than their pads for the Teves caliper.

However I think I must have Teves caliper and that the Brembo caliper is actually the BMW performance upgrade.
